According to some studies, from 1995 to 2015 India witnessed an approximate 43% increase in cardiovascular deaths on the contrary western countries observed a 50% decrease in cardiovascular deaths. In India, 40% of cardiovascular deaths are seen in the age group of 40 years and above. While encountering cardiovascular diseases in relation to dyslipidemia, lipid profile of the patient plays a crucial role. Dyslipidemia is a term used to demonstrate for abnormal growth of lipids in the blood.
Screening coupled with ample lipid profile calculation plays a crucial role in lipid management. Based on the severity of the disease the lipid profile could be calculated as mild, moderate and severe.
